BMW S1000RR Specification

New BMW S1000RR has some additional features, but design in general is not much different from previous editions because of the BMW S1000RR looks exactly the same, the German company has done a lot of hope for the bike to make prospective buyers of BMW S1000RR halo gives a good view from the top next season, although will enter the third year of production 2012 BMW S1000RR have an engine that produces 193hp to achieve the same strength in the heart of the BMW S1000RR., and curb weight remains paltry 449 pounds (90% fuel) 2012 BMW  S1000RR have a bevy suspension, chassis, and electronics for the new model year.

Although more of an evolution of the company’s first stab at a proper sports bike, probably the most prominent changes in the BMW S1000RR is a revised frame, which saw revisions to the steering head angle motors, offset, shaft position swingarm, fork projection, and a buffer spring the length. BMW also has an enlarged air intake, which runs through the steering head, has a larger cross section that produces a better airflow to the airbox. Other chassis changes include changes to internal suspension, along with some cosmetic changes to the fairing bikes (including a new color scheme) and re-vamped gauge cluster. BMW lists the full extent of the changes made to 2012 BMW S1000RR as follows:

1.      Optimized for ridability improved torque curve.
2.      Expansion from two to three performance curves (one each for Rain and Sport mode and an additional one for Race and Slick mode); Rain mode now 120 kW (163 hp).
3.      Reset throttle to improve responsiveness (especially delicate and sensitive acceleration in Rain mode, spontaneous and direct response and direct in Sport mode, Race and Slick).
4.      Reducing the force-grip twist and turn a tight angle.
5.      A smaller ratio of secondary to push and push.
6.      Refined tuning Race ABS and Dynamic Traction Control (DTC).
7.      Enlarged cross-sectional area of?? Air intake guide through the steering head for greater airflow efficiency.
8.      Better handling, steering accuracy, and feedback.
9.      Revision of the spring element for an even wider range of damping force.
10.  Suspension geometry modified with new values? For the steering head angle, offset, shaft position swing arm, fork projections, and the length of the spring strut?.
11.  New mechanical adjustable steering damper is more than ten levels.
12.  Fork bridge forged and milled in a new design and with a smaller offset.
13.  Revised design with a slimmer tail section, redesigned side panels, airbox center with cover grille aperture, and wings.
14.  For the new color variants: Racing Red plain white with the Alps, Bluefire, Sapphire black metallic, BMW Motorrad Motorsport colors.
15.  Revision RR logo.
16.  Plate slender heel and a new stabilizer on the passenger footrests.
17.  LCD displays a redesigned engine speeds for better readability and with five levels of dimming.
18.  Instrument cluster with “Best round lasts’ new functions and” Speedwarning “; deactivation message” Lamp “error when the headlamps or operator license plates removed.
19.  Catalytic converter relocated, so there is no heat shield is required.
